Today I am no longer who I thought I was. I used to put all sorts of labels on myself. And I used to believe the labels that others put on me. NO MORE!  It was kind of funny, when the ‘light bulb’ went off for me.  I used to be depressed.  I used to take medicine and not get out of bed. And all day I would talk about how depressed I was to whoever would listen.  The more I talked about it the worse I felt. And then, in my eyes – I BECAME depression. Talk about a downer!  LOL!  Things only started to change for me when I kept my mouth shut and stopped repeating the negative words over myself.  I had to stop beating myself up with my words – especially when I looked in the mirror. And I had to start speaking positive words over myself – whether I liked it or not, whether I felt it or not.

Then, I had to learn the truth. Who does God say I am? Because obviously, I had no idea.  I gave my power away and let others define me – what a mistake.  No wonder I was an easy target for an Abuser.  He could tell me whatever he wanted to and I would believe it. And seriously, after hearing those words day in and day out for years – you get brainwashed into thinking they are true.  I won’t repeat those words – even here, but I am sure you have your own “words” that were spoken over you that were harmful.

I can testify that those words can be broken off – and turned into dust.  But you have to speak to your own mountain to get it to move.  Your body responds to your voice.  I encourage you to speak the WORD over your life – and watch and see what happens!  If you need those positive words – print this out and put it on your mirror:
